The Role of Trees in Cultural Traditions

The Role of Trees in Cultural Traditions

Trees have played a significant ‌role in various cultural traditions and practices around ⁣the‍ world for ⁤centuries. From sacred groves⁤ and ritual plantings to folklore and symbolism, the​ presence of trees in ‌different societies‌ holds deep significance. This article⁢ explores the multifaceted relationship between trees and cultural traditions, shedding light on the diverse ways​ in which these majestic beings have ​shaped ⁣human beliefs and practices throughout history.

Trees have played a significant role in ⁢cultural beliefs around the world for centuries, serving as symbols⁤ of life, wisdom, and spiritual connection. In many ⁢traditions, certain tree species are believed to ‍possess​ magical‌ or healing properties, ⁤with rituals and ceremonies centered around their presence. Trees ‌are often ​seen as ‌a ⁢bridge ​between the earthly and spiritual ‌realms, with their roots grounding us in the physical world and their branches reaching towards the heavens.

Historically, trees have been used in a variety of ‍traditional practices, from creating sacred‌ spaces and altars to using specific tree‌ parts‌ in spiritual ceremonies. For⁣ example, in⁤ Celtic traditions,⁣ the ⁤Oak tree ‌was revered as a symbol of strength and wisdom, while⁣ the Yew tree was associated with‍ death and rebirth. In contemporary times, efforts to preserve⁣ and conserve tree species in cultural traditions have become increasingly important, as deforestation and climate change threaten the existence of many sacred trees. By protecting these valuable resources, we can ensure that future generations can‌ continue to benefit from the rich symbolism⁤ and rituals surrounding trees in⁢ cultural beliefs.

Q&A

Q: What‍ is the ‍significance of trees ⁢in cultural traditions?
A: Trees hold a significant role in⁣ cultural traditions around the ⁢world, often symbolizing life,⁤ strength, and wisdom. They are ⁣often seen as sacred or spiritual symbols in‍ many cultures.

Q: How have trees been ⁤used in traditional ceremonies?
A: Trees have been used in traditional‍ ceremonies ​for various⁤ purposes, such as ⁤offering prayers, conducting⁢ rituals, or ‌celebrating festivals. In‍ some cultures, trees⁤ are believed to‍ be inhabited by spirits or gods ‌and are treated with reverence and ‌respect.

Q: Can you give examples of trees and their symbolic meanings in‌ different cultures?
A: In Celtic culture, the oak tree represents strength⁢ and endurance, while the willow tree symbolizes intuition and healing. In Japanese culture, the cherry⁤ blossom tree is a‌ symbol of beauty and transience, while the⁣ pine tree represents‍ longevity and resilience.

Q: How have‌ trees inspired folk ​tales and legends?
A: ​Trees ⁣have⁣ inspired countless folk tales and legends, often portraying them as magical or mystical beings. For example, the Norse Yggdrasil​ tree is said to ‌connect the ⁣nine realms of the ⁤universe, while the African Baobab tree ‍is believed to be the dwelling ⁣place of spirits.

Q: What is​ the environmental significance of trees in cultural traditions?
A: Trees ⁢play ⁤a crucial role in maintaining the balance of ecosystems and providing​ essential resources for human⁣ survival. ‌Many cultures have ​recognized the‍ importance of preserving and protecting trees as a means of sustaining life on Earth.
